How much do laminator operator jobs pay per hour?

As of Jun 10, 2026, the average hourly pay for laminator operator in the United States is $19.09,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$17.07 and $20.43 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are some common challenges faced by Laminator Operators and how can they be addressed?

Laminator Operators often encounter challenges such as maintaining consistent machine performance, ensuring material alignment, and troubleshooting equipment issues. Working closely with maintenance teams and following standard operating procedures can help minimize downtime and improve product quality. Effective communication with team members on the production line is also crucial for meeting deadlines and addressing any issues quickly. Staying organized and proactive about preventive maintenance makes the role more manageable and contributes to a smoother workflow.

What are Laminator Operators?

Laminator Operators are skilled workers responsible for setting up, operating, and maintaining machines that laminate materials, such as paper, plastic, or textiles. Their main task is to ensure products are coated or bonded with a protective or decorative layer using heat, pressure, or adhesives. They monitor the machinery, check for quality standards, troubleshoot any issues, and ensure safety protocols are followed during production. Laminator Operators are essential in industries such as packaging, printing, and manufacturing where laminated materials are commonly used.

Job description

Sheridan MN is seeking a Laminator Operator for first shift, Monday - Friday.

What You'll Do:

  • Setup and run the Laminator and/or UV Coater.
  • Monitor quality of product per the job ticket and established procedures.
  • Complete all paperwork and maintain the equipment with preventative maintenance.

Basic Qualifications:

  • High School diploma or equivalent.
  • Ability to read, do basic math and work with basic tools (screw drivers, wrenches, etc.)
  • Possess basic computer skills (i.e. Windows type applications.)
  • Possess mechanical inclination and have the ability to troubleshoot equipment issues.

Desired Skills and Abilities:

  • Two years + in trade on similar equipment.
  • Graphic arts and/or technical school background.

Physical Requirements:

Work is performed in a factory environment with regular exposure to dust, dirt, noise and the physical hazards of machinery, plus some exposure to fumes, oils, lubricants, and chemicals.

  • Hearing protection and safety toe shoes are required.
  • Prolonged periods of standing up to 12 hours.
  • Ability to lift up to 50 pounds.
